當前位置:首頁 » 操作系統 » jsp中刪除資料庫數據

jsp中刪除資料庫數據

發布時間: 2025-06-30 15:12:08

java怎樣用jsp實現對資料庫的增刪改查操作 並給給出程序步驟

在Java中使用JSP實現資料庫的增刪改查操作是一種常見的方法。JSP頁面可以結合Java代碼實現動態網頁功能,增強網頁的交互性和靈活性。實現這些操作的基礎是Servlet和JDBC技術。在JSP頁面中,可以使用<%%>標簽將Java代碼嵌入到HTML中,以實現頁面的動態更新。

首先,需要在JSP頁面中導入相應的包。例如,為了連接資料庫,需要導入java.sql.*包。同時,還需要導入其他相關包,如javax.servlet.*和javax.servlet.http.*,以便處理HTTP請求和響應。

其次,通過創建JDBC連接來訪問資料庫。可以使用DriverManager.getConnection()方法來連接資料庫,其中包含資料庫的URL、用戶名和密碼。在連接成功後,可以創建Statement對象或者PreparedStatement對象來執行SQL語句。

在執行增刪改查操作時,可以編寫相應的SQL語句。例如,使用INSERT語句進行數據插入,使用UPDATE語句更新數據,使用DELETE語句刪除數據,使用SELECT語句查詢數據。在JSP頁面中,可以通過request對象獲取表單提交的數據,然後將這些數據傳遞給SQL語句中的佔位符。

在執行SQL語句之後,需要處理結果。對於INSERT、UPDATE和DELETE語句,可以通過Statement對象的executeUpdate()方法執行,該方法返回執行SQL語句影響的行數。對於SELECT語句,可以通過Statement對象的executeQuery()方法執行,然後通過ResultSet對象獲取查詢結果。

在JSP頁面中展示查詢結果時,可以使用JSTL標簽庫簡化頁面的編寫。例如,使用<c:forEach>標簽遍歷查詢結果集,然後使用<c:out>標簽顯示每行數據。同時,還可以使用JSTL的條件判斷標簽來判斷查詢結果是否為空。

最後,需要在JSP頁面中添加適當的表單元素,以便用戶輸入數據進行增刪改查操作。例如,可以添加文本框、下拉列表和按鈕等元素。在表單提交時,可以將用戶輸入的數據傳遞給後台JSP頁面,然後在後台處理這些數據,執行相應的SQL語句。

總之,通過在JSP頁面中嵌入Java代碼並結合JDBC技術,可以實現資料庫的增刪改查操作。需要注意的是,在編寫SQL語句時要保證安全性,避免SQL注入攻擊。同時,要確保資料庫連接的關閉,避免資源泄露。

熱點內容
編譯原理期末章節復習 發布:2025-06-30 21:58:47 瀏覽:794
恆強製版編譯顯示時間 發布:2025-06-30 21:58:04 瀏覽:461
加密軟體恆 發布:2025-06-30 21:49:18 瀏覽:633
工廠方法java 發布:2025-06-30 21:48:39 瀏覽:963
如何反編譯exe 發布:2025-06-30 21:41:34 瀏覽:373
虛擬伺服器如何搭建使用 發布:2025-06-30 21:40:09 瀏覽:823
linuxminicom 發布:2025-06-30 21:31:54 瀏覽:546
360硬碟加密軟體 發布:2025-06-30 21:31:10 瀏覽:681
將優盤加密 發布:2025-06-30 21:22:15 瀏覽:79
中考成績密碼忘了如何找回密碼 發布:2025-06-30 21:16:01 瀏覽:951